  • Cheryl Hines (born September 21, 1965) is an American actress and television director, best known for her role as Larry David’s wife Cheryl on HBO’s Curb Your Enthusiasm. In 2009 she made her directorial debut at the Tribeca Film Festival with Serious Moonlight.

Great communication skills are necessary in today’s collaborative classrooms. In this video, Emmy-nominated actress Cheryl Hines shares tips from her field- improvisational acting- with teachers at the Florida Council for Exceptional Children State Conference to promote better collaboration in inclusive classrooms. In addition to her work in television and movies, Cheryl is on the National Board of Directors for United Cerebral Palsy.
